Researchers praise ‘stunning’ results of new prostate cancer treatment
Early trials of the drug VIR-5500 showed it shrinking tumours in some patients
A new drug for advanced prostate cancer has shown promise in early trials experts have said, with the medication shrinking tumours in some patients.
Prostate cancer is the most common cancer among men in many countries, including the US and UK. About 1.5 million men are diagnosed worldwide each year.

Tennis: Darderi wins in Santiago after Cobolli's Acapulco triumph
(ANSA) - ROME, MAR 2 - Italy's Luciano Darderi beat German Yannick Hanfmann 7-6 (6) 7-5 on Sunday to win the ATP 250 tournament in Santiago, Chile, on the same weekend that his compatriot Flavio Cobolli triumphed at the Acapulco ATP 500 with a victory over American Frances Tiafoe.
Darderi's triumph means he is the player to have the most tour-level clay titles since the start of the 2024 season - five, one more than world number one Carlos Alcaraz.

BusinessThe Guardianpublico2d ago2 sources BA owner’s profits rise by 20% despite drop in passenger numbers last year
IAG enjoys record operating profits on margins of more than 15% at British Airways and sister airline Iberia
British Airways’ owner, International Airlines Group (IAG), has announced a sharp rise in annual profits to almost £4bn despite carrying slightly fewer passengers in 2025.
Pre-tax profits across the group increased by 20% to €4.5bn (£3.9bn), with record operating profits on margins of more than 15% at BA and its sister airline Iberia.
